What Is This Tool?
This converter transforms power measurements from watts (W), which quantify energy transfer per second, into calories (th)/second, a thermal power unit based on the thermochemical calorie definition.

Examples
-
10 Watts equals approximately 2.390057361 Calorie (th)/second
-
50 Watts equals approximately 11.950286805 Calorie (th)/second

Frequently Asked Questions
-
What does 1 watt represent in terms of energy?
-
One watt equals one joule of energy transferred or converted per second, measuring the rate of work done or energy used.
-
Why use calorie (th)/second instead of watts?
-
Calorie (th)/second is useful for analyzing thermal power, heat flow, or legacy thermal measurements in specific thermal engineering and calorimetry contexts.
-
What is the conversion formula between watt and calorie (th)/second?
-
1 watt equals approximately 0.2390057361 calorie (th)/second.
Key Terminology
-
Watt [W]
-
The SI derived unit of power equal to one joule per second, representing the rate of energy transfer or work done.
-
Calorie (th)/second
-
A unit of power representing the transfer of one thermochemical calorie of energy per second, where one calorie (th) equals exactly 4.184 joules.
